The 55th running of the World 100 at Eldora returns this weekend, and racing fans have been planning their watch parties all week. The three-day event for DIRTcar Super Late Models takes place in Rossburg, Ohio, featuring the best Dirt Late Model drivers in the world at one of the oldest and most prestigious races.

The events kick off with twin 25-lap, $12,000 preliminary features Thursday and Friday. That leads to heat races and consolations Saturday, followed by the 100-lap main event that boasts an event-record $72,000 grand prize. The total purse for the entire weekend exceeds $600,000.

Bobby Pierce of Oakwood, Illinois, serves as the reigning champion, as he eked by Dale McDowell for his second career World 100 victory and first since 2016. Pierce also won last season's $100,000 Dirt Track World Championship at Eldora, so it's safe to say he likes this half-mile dirt oval in Ohio.

Jonathan Davenport of Blairsville, Georgia enters with 11 Eldora crown jewels, including five World 100 victories (2015, '17, '19, '21 and '22). One more World 100 win and he will tie Billy Moyer for most ever.

How to watch World 100 at Eldora 2025

The World 100 at Eldora will not air on national TV. It will, however, be available to stream on FloRacing, which provides subscribers with access to live streams, event replays and FloSports Originals.
